Ingredients

Cosecha Merlot is made primarily from Merlot grapes. These grapes are known for their soft tannins and fruity flavours. Other ingredients may include small amounts of Cabernet Sauvignon or Cabernet Franc to enhance complexity. The simplicity of its ingredients allows the natural grape flavours to shine.

Preparation

The preparation of Cosecha Merlot involves harvesting ripe grapes at the right time. After harvesting, the grapes are crushed and fermented. This process converts sugars into alcohol. The wine is then aged in oak barrels to develop its flavour profile. The aging process can vary from a few months to several years.

Flavour Profile

Cosecha Merlot is known for its smooth and velvety texture. It offers flavours of plum, cherry, and chocolate. The wine has a medium body with low acidity, making it easy to drink. Its balanced taste appeals to both new and seasoned wine drinkers.

Pairings

Cosecha Merlot pairs well with a variety of foods. It complements dishes like roasted chicken, grilled vegetables, and pasta with tomato sauce. Its versatility makes it suitable for both casual meals and formal dinners. Cheese lovers will find it pairs nicely with mild cheeses.

Serving Suggestions

To enjoy Cosecha Merlot at its best, serve it at room temperature or slightly chilled. Use a wide-bowled glass to allow the aromas to develop fully. Decanting the wine before serving can enhance its flavours by allowing it to breathe.

Interesting Facts

Did you know that Merlot means "young blackbird" in French? This name refers to the dark colour of the grapes. Another interesting fact is that Cosecha Merlot was once considered inferior but has since gained respect among wine enthusiasts.
